Quick note on the Larkspur garage occupancy feed: the sensors are chatty and occasionally double-count cars at the ramp, so we smooth readings over a short window before publishing. If the feed looks frozen at 3 a.m., it's probably just the quiet-hours sampling slowdown, not an outage. The smoothing and polling constants are these.

constants for fajop-tahaf:
RATE_LIMITS = {
    "holael": 2,
    "oliael": 10,
    "druael": 10,
    "wenwyn": 10,
}

## Add backpressure to notification fan-out

This PR introduces bounded queues in Pingwell's fan-out worker so a slow downstream (usually the digest renderer) can no longer stall the whole pipeline. When the queue fills, we shed low-priority notifications first and emit a `fanout_shed` metric you should watch during incidents. The constants below control queue depth and shed thresholds.

tuning table, yajog-yahof:
BUDGETS = {
    "lamvan": 303,
    "wenox": 460,
    "fenvan": 525,
}

## Thumbnail Queue (Snapstack)

When users upload images to Fernvale Albums, the thumbnail jobs land in a queue table inside the Snapstack database. If customers complain about missing thumbnails, it's almost always a backlog here — check the `pending_jobs` count first. Jobs older than an hour usually mean a stuck worker, so ping the on-call before retrying anything manually. To poke around the queue yourself, use the read-only connection string below.

primary connection of yagep-kahip = redis://giliel_svc:zYiKsLL2PLpfPL@db-348f.xolmarsys.corp:5432/fenwyn

Rows in the Marlowe orders table are never hard-deleted. The `DELETE /orders/:id` endpoint sets `deleted_at` and hides the row from default queries. Pass `include_deleted=true` to see tombstones. Restores go through `POST /orders/:id/restore`. All calls require the internal Ordervault service key, shown here.

service key, fawip-bajef: kto11_Qt5wZK9vdNC

Subject: DR drill Thursday — report export timezones

During Thursday's disaster-recovery drill we'll fail Pellworth report exports over to the Darnby region. Watch for timestamps rendering in UTC instead of the tenant's configured zone — that was last drill's regression. If the export scheduler loses its session during failover, restore it from the sealed config, which prompts for the recovery passphrase, shown below.

vault phrase of tajop-haduf = holath-brivan-wenax